The "first" of anything is almost always a pretty crude start to something new and different. But it gave a base idea to build upon and is certainly a collectors item...even if the performance is shoddy compared to later Digital Receivers. I was Test Supervisor at WJ-CEI when the 8888 was designed and can recall the  effort put forth by the Engineering group to get the first unit to operate well enough to get through an open house equipment display. It was received so well by our customers that....if I recall correctly...we quickly built about 50 production units to fill orders. That's when the nasty stuff really hit the fan. Instant Boatanchors. After some redesign however, the units were again manufactured and shipped to customers who for the most part were satisfied with the latest receiver technology available at the time (abt 1972-1973). WJ continued to improve on the design and other manufacturers jumped in with their designs. 
Your assessment of the 8888 is pretty accurate, but doesn't take into account the state of the art of electronics at the time.
